Various steel scraps are used for some raw materials of cast iron. In this research, the ratio of garbage melt metal and electrolytic iron was varied at 0 : 100, 25 : 75, 50 : 50, 75 : 25, and 100 : 0. Flake graphite cast iron was made by using these materials, and the microstructure and mechanical properties were examined. The content of copper and phosphorus increased when the mixing ratio of the garbage melt metal increased. When the mixing ratio increased, pearlite and steadite were observed by matrix and the hardness of Brinell increased. The tensile strength increased up to 75% of the mixing ratio garbage melt metal, but decreased above it. This results in shrinkage by steadite in matrix.
